> >>> "Cable is only for PCs?" Who is your local cable
> >> provider?
> >>>
> >>> Now, in Texas (Houston) I use DSL via SBC/Yahoo,
> >> but in Georgia I use a cable
> >>> modem via Charter Cable. I remember when I got
> the
> >> cable modem - back when I
> >>> knew nothing of high-speed internet - I was told
> >> numerous times by the techs
> >>> at Charter Cable that their system did not work
> >> with Macs.
> >>>
> >>> However, a few local friends (and LEM listers)
> >> assured me that, while all of
> >>> the software that accompanied/supported the
> cable
> >> modem MAY be for PCs only,
> >>> as long as the modem was working and had an
> >> ethernet connection it had to work
> >>> with a Mac.
> >>>
> >>> Sure enough, the software was all PC, but since
> I
> >> had a PC anyway at my home,
> >>> I use it to configure everything and then hooked
> a
> >> router to the modem.
> >>> Voila! My Macs w/ etherent ports were of course
> >> able to use it.
> >>>
> >>> Nowadays, most high-speed modems seem to have
> the
> >> web-page configuration
> >>> option anyway, using an IP address, as opposed
> to
> >> actual software. SBC/Yahoo DSL
> >>> had both I believe. And if USB v. ethernet is
> the
> >> problem, as your cable
> >>> provider if they can supply you with a modem for
> >> ethernet connections. I think that
> >>> may have been an issue with Charter for me also,
> >> as I remember having to
> >>> request a ethernet modem.
> >>>
> >>> Finally, remember that some places like Best Buy
> >> sell modems also. Be sure to
> >>> get one that works with your particular service.
